Jacksonville is a consolidated city-county, home to over 842,500 residents, and is the largest city in the state of Florida by both population and by total area, and also the largest city in the contiguous U.S. by total area.

Jacksonville became a consolidated city-county in 1968, after residents decided to merge the city government with what was then Duval County. Jacksonville is a major military area, and is also a major U.S. port; the Port of Jacksonville is a major deep-water seaport and also the third-largest port in the state of Florida.

Jacksonville is one of the oldest cities in the state of Florida, with a founding date of 1791. This preceded the sale of Florida to the U.S. by almost thirty years. After it came under U.S. control, railroads were built to connect Jacksonville with the rest of the United States, causing a small population boom that lasted for a few years.

Jacksonville was hurt by the American Civil War, as it was a Confederate port blockaded by Union forces early in the war, though no major battles were fought there. After the war, Jacksonville saw resurgence, and the population again began to rise. Today, Jacksonville is a major U.S. city and the largest in Florida, and is one of the largest economic centers in the North Coast area of Florida.

During the summer months, average daily highs in Jacksonville typically reach into the low 90’s, though higher temperatures have been recorded. Overnight, lows tend to drop down into the low-to-mid 70’s. Winter months bring more mild temperatures, with highs usually reaching into the mid-to-upper 60’s and overnight lows dropping into the low-to-mid 40’s.

Jacksonville is a popular snowbird destination; residents of northern states will often buy winter homes in Jacksonville and other cities in Florida to enjoy the mild winter weather and escape the brutal New England or Great Lake winters.
